Role Purpose
The Product Operations Intern will support internal business teams in managing and improving warehouse management systems, logistics platforms, courier integrations, order flow tools, and operational dashboards. The role will work closely with warehouse, inventory, logistics, product, and tech teams to resolve system issues, track operational bugs, document workflows, support UAT, and improve system adoption across fulfillment operations.
Key Responsibilities
- Support day-to-day issue tracking for WMS, OMS, courier platforms, logistics dashboards, and internal operational tools.
- Coordinate with warehouse, logistics, inventory, customer support, and tech teams to understand system-related issues and follow up for closure.
- Maintain trackers for bugs, feature requests, integration failures, order stuck cases, AWB issues, stock sync issues, and user escalations.
- Assist in preparing BRDs, user stories, process flows, SOPs, test cases, and release notes for product and system improvements.
- Support UAT for new features, system changes, courier integrations, warehouse workflows, and automation rollouts.
- Monitor operational exceptions such as order flow failures, dispatch blockers, AWB generation errors, tracking sync issues, and inventory mismatches.
- Help create dashboards and MIS reports to track issue aging, SLA impact, platform adoption, and repeated operational problems.
- Support training and documentation for internal users to ensure correct usage of WMS, logistics platforms, and fulfillment tools.
- Identify repetitive manual work and suggest product/process improvements to reduce errors and escalations.
- Work on special projects related to fulfillment automation, logistics optimization, system adoption, and operational efficiency.
Key Learning Areas
- Ecommerce order lifecycle from order placement to delivery and returns
- Warehouse management system workflows including GRN, putaway, picking, packing, dispatch, and stock adjustment
- Courier platform workflows including AWB generation, tracking, NDR, RTO, and reverse logistics
- Product operations, UAT, BRD writing, SOP creation, and stakeholder coordination
- Dashboarding, issue tracking, root cause analysis, and process improvement
